Las Vegas, a dazzling city nestled in the Nevada desert, pulsates with an electric energy that thrives 24/7. Often called “Sin City” or simply “Vegas,” it’s a place where the allure of chance encounters and extravagant entertainment beckons millions of visitors each year.

Step into a gambler’s paradise. Floor-to-ceiling slot machines beckon with flashing lights and the rhythmic clinking of chips fills the air. But Las Vegas offers more than just rolling the dice. Immerse yourself in world-class entertainment with extravagant live shows featuring renowned musicians, laugh-out-loud comedians, and gravity-defying Cirque du Soleil productions.

Las Vegas is a feast for the senses. Michelin-starred restaurants present exquisite culinary creations, while celebrity chef restaurants add a touch of glamour to your meal. For a more casual approach, buffets overflowing with international flavors offer endless choices. Las Vegas caters to every shopper’s fancy. High-end designer stores line the streets, while expansive luxury malls showcase the latest trends. Themed resorts like The Venetian recreate iconic landmarks, allowing you to explore the canals of Venice or marvel at a replica of the Eiffel Tower, all while indulging in retail therapy.

Thrilling adventures abound in Las Vegas. Take a heart-stopping ride on the High Roller, the world’s tallest observation wheel, or soar above the Fremont Street pedestrian mall on a zip line. Helicopter tours whisk you away for breathtaking aerial views of the neon-lit city and the vast desert landscape. But Las Vegas isn’t just for adults. Family-friendly resorts offer arcades, amusement parks, and interactive experiences to keep children entertained. Explore the underwater wonders at the SEA LIFE Aquarium or ignite young minds with the engaging exhibits at the Discovery Children’s Museum. Las Vegas offers a dazzling world where the extraordinary becomes ordinary, a place fueled by vibrant energy and an endless array of experiences waiting to be discovered.

Top 10 Attractions in Las Vegas, NV
  • The Las Vegas Strip: The heart and soul of Las Vegas, the Strip is a dazzling display of iconic hotels and casinos, each with its own unique theme and experiences. From the romantic canals of The Venetian Resort to the towering Eiffel Tower replica at Paris Las Vegas, it’s a sensory overload in the best way possible.
  • Fremont Street Experience: Take a walk down this pedestrian mall, a historic section of Las Vegas known for its vibrant lights, street performers, live music, and vintage casinos. Experience the Fremont Street Experience light shows, a dazzling canopy of LED lights that create a mesmerizing visual spectacle.
  • High Roller at The LINQ: Ascend to new heights on the High Roller, the world’s tallest observation wheel. This 550-foot behemoth offers stunning panoramic views of the Las Vegas skyline and the surrounding desert landscape.
  • Grand Canyon National Park: Although not directly in Las Vegas, the Grand Canyon is a must-see natural wonder easily accessible with a day trip. Witness the awe-inspiring multicolored rock formations carved by the Colorado River over millions of years. Hike along the rim or take a helicopter tour for breathtaking aerial views.
  • World-Class Entertainment: Las Vegas is a haven for live entertainment. Catch a dazzling Cirque du Soleil production, laugh along with a renowned comedian, or be mesmerized by a concert from your favorite musician. From intimate jazz clubs to grand theaters, the variety of shows caters to all tastes.
  • Fine Dining Extravaganza: Las Vegas is a haven for foodies, boasting a collection of Michelin-starred restaurants featuring exquisite culinary creations from celebrity chefs. Savor dishes prepared with the freshest ingredients and presented with artistic flair.
  • Thrilling Adventures: Las Vegas caters to adrenaline junkies. Take a heart-pounding ride on the stratospheric observation wheel or embark on a zip line adventure above the Fremont Street crowds. Helicopter tours provide breathtaking aerial views of the neon-lit city and the surrounding desert landscape.
  • Neon Museum: Take a step back in time and explore the vibrant history of Las Vegas signage at the Neon Museum. Witness the iconic signs of famous casinos and hotels, many beautifully restored and illuminated against the desert sky.
  • Museums Galore: Las Vegas offers a surprising variety of museums beyond the glitz and glamor. Explore the Mob Museum and delve into the city’s fascinating gangster history, or visit the National Atomic Testing Museum to learn about the atomic age.
  • Family-Friendly Fun: Las Vegas isn’t just for adults! Several resorts cater to families with arcades, amusement parks, and interactive experiences. Immerse yourselves in underwater wonders at the SEA LIFE Aquarium or explore the engaging exhibits at the Discovery Children’s Museum. Las Vegas offers something for everyone, even the little ones.
Top 10 Dining Experiences in Las Vegas, NV
  • Joël Robuchon at MGM Grand: Experience the legacy of the late “Chef of the Century,” Joël Robuchon. This French restaurant offers an opulent setting and exquisite tasting menus featuring classic French cuisine with a modern twist.
  • Nobu at Caesars Palace: Indulge in world-renowned Nobu cuisine, a fusion of Japanese and Peruvian flavors. Savor fresh sushi, melt-in-your-mouth black cod with miso, and signature dishes like Wagyu beef tacos.
  • Restaurant Guy Savoy at Caesars Palace: French haute cuisine takes center stage at Restaurant Guy Savoy. Expect impeccable service, breathtaking views of the Bellagio fountains, and an unforgettable dining experience with a focus on fresh, seasonal ingredients.
  • Wing Lei at Wynn Las Vegas: Dive into the world of fine Cantonese cuisine at Wing Lei. This Michelin-starred restaurant boasts elegant dim sum lunches and delectable multi-course dinners featuring skillfully prepared seafood, meats, and vegetables.
  • Yellowtail Japanese Restaurant & Sushi Bar: Yellowtail offers a vibrant and stylish setting to enjoy contemporary Japanese cuisine. Savor an extensive sushi and sashimi selection, or indulge in creative maki rolls and innovative hot dishes.
  • Bacchanal Buffet at Caesars Palace: Embark on a culinary world tour at the legendary Bacchanal Buffet. This extravagant buffet boasts over 500 dishes from around the globe, featuring fresh seafood, carved meats, international specialties, and decadent desserts.
  • Eataly Las Vegas: Immerse yourself in all things Italian at Eataly. This sprawling marketplace features a variety of restaurants, cafes, and shops offering authentic Italian cuisine. Enjoy fresh pasta dishes, wood-fired pizzas, cured meats, and delicious cheeses.
  • Best Friend Park: This trendy spot offers a unique Korean-Mexican fusion experience. Savor dishes like kimchi fried rice with bulgogi or Korean BBQ tacos, alongside creative cocktails and a lively atmosphere.
  • Momofuku: David Chang’s Momofuku brings innovative Asian flavors to Las Vegas. Choose from various concepts within the restaurant, each offering a distinct culinary experience, from ramen and noodles at Noodle Bar to steamed buns and buns at Bao.
  • Bouchon at The Venetian: This charming French bistro offers a taste of Parisian charm. Enjoy classic dishes like steak frites, decadent pastries, and an extensive wine list in a sophisticated yet relaxed setting.
Top 10 Travel Tips for Las Vegas, NV
  • Plan for the Heat and Crowds: Las Vegas sunshine can be scorching, especially during the summer months. Pack light, breathable clothing, a hat, sunglasses, and sunscreen. Consider the time of year – shoulder seasons (spring and fall) offer smaller crowds and potentially better deals.
  • Budget for More Than Gambling: While Las Vegas is known for casinos, entertainment, dining, and activities all come at a cost. Factor in additional expenses beyond your gambling budget. Look for deals on shows, buffets, and attractions.
  • Embrace Free Entertainment: Las Vegas offers a surprising amount of free entertainment. Be mesmerized by the erupting Bellagio fountains, stroll through the vibrant Fremont Street Experience with its dazzling light shows and street performers, or explore the unique shops at the Forum Shops at Caesars Palace.
  • Utilize the Las Vegas Monorail: The Las Vegas Monorail offers a convenient and affordable way to navigate the Strip, avoiding the hassle of traffic and long walks, especially during the hot summer months. Purchase a multi-day pass for even greater savings.
  • Consider Show Tickets in Advance: Popular shows can sell out quickly, especially during peak seasons. Research shows you’d like to see and purchase tickets in advance to avoid disappointment.
  • Walk the Strip (at Your Own Pace): The Las Vegas Strip is a pedestrian paradise, designed for strolling and taking in the sights. However, the distances can be deceiving, so wear comfortable shoes and plan breaks for rest and hydration.
  • Free Casino Drinks (with a Catch): Casinos often offer complimentary drinks to gamblers. While tempting, be mindful of your alcohol consumption and gamble responsibly. Remember, free drinks are usually slower to come by if you’re not actively playing.
  • Explore Beyond the Strip: Venture beyond the dazzling lights of the Strip for a different perspective. Explore the historic Fremont Street, visit museums for a dose of culture, or take a day trip to the breathtaking natural beauty of the Grand Canyon National Park.
  • Dress Code Savvy: Las Vegas caters to various styles; however, some high-end restaurants and nightclubs may have dress codes (think collared shirts and dress shoes for men, cocktail dresses or skirts for women). Pack accordingly if you plan on hitting these spots.
  • Hydration is Key: Don’t underestimate the desert heat. Carry a reusable water bottle and refill it frequently throughout the day to avoid dehydration, especially when exploring outdoors or waiting in lines.
